
Urhobo traditional religion
Urhobo traditional religion, practiced by the Urhobo people of Nigeria, centers on a belief in a supreme deity called Okiruwor, along with ancestral spirits and lesser deities. It emphasizes harmony with nature, reverence for ancestors, and ritual practices to seek guidance, protection, and blessings. Rituals often involve offerings, prayers, and ceremonies conducted by community elders or priests. The religion fosters moral values, social cohesion, and respect for traditions, blending spiritual beliefs with daily life. While influenced by Christianity today, Urhobo traditional religion remains an important cultural and spiritual foundation for many Urhobo people.
